Abstract
BACKGROUND: Glycophorin variants of the MNSs blood group are important in Taiwan. For more than 20 years, screening for the most frequent irregular antibody, anti-''Mi(a)', has been conducted by using 'Mi(a)'(+) RBCs, with a significant success. However, the sensitivity and the specificity of this screening strategy have never been validated, and the true incidences of different glycophorin variants in Taiwan have been in controversy. Also, the significance of another less frequent and usually separately reported variant, St(a), has never been evaluated. METHODOLOGY/PRINCIPALEntities:

PCR primers used in this study, including their precise locations.
| Primers used in this study | |||
| Name of primer | Location | Sequence | Comment |
| 797A | nt 660-679 of IN2 | 5'-GCA GTC ACC TCA TTC TTG AC-3' |
|
| 2026B | nt 116-87 of IN4 | 5'-GTT AAC AAC ATA TGC TCT TCT GTT TTA AG-3' |
|
| GPABA_E3R | nt 110-80 of IN3 | 5'-ATG GGT TTT CTG TCA CGA AAG CTT GAG AAC T-3' |
|
| 797B | nt 663-682 of IN2 | 5'-GCA GTC ACC TCA TTC TTG TT-3' |
|
| Sta_E4F | nt 38-19 of EX4 | 5'-TGG TTC AGA GAA ATG ATG GG-3' |
|
| F2 | nt 683 of IN2 - nt 4 of EX3 | 5'-CCC TTT CTC AAC TTC TCT TAT ATG CAG ATA A-3' |
|
| Rccgg | nt 28 of IN3 - nt 91 of EX3 | 5'-GAG CAA CTA TTT AAA ACT AAG AAC ATA CCG G-3' |
|
*From Ref. [7].
**Originally designed.
***From Ref. [13]. IN:intron. EX:exon.
